Background Story:
Grand Inquisitor Isillien was an human priest the spiritual heart of the Scarlet Crusade in the Western Plaguelands.
At the time of the Third War, Isillien was a member of the Order of the Silver Hand. He was eventually summoned by Highlord Mograine at the inn of Southshore, along with Doan, Fairbanks, and Abbendis. He was initially hostile to Alexandros' idea to purify the dark crystal he found from an orc warlock during the Second War, and even tried to destroy it with Smite - only to find out it absorbed the Light. He then agreed to participate in Doan's experiment, and together, they succeeded in purifying what would later become the heart of the Ashbringer.
Following the death of Alexandros, he joined the ranks of the Scarlet Crusade and organized the ceremony of induction of Renault Mograine as a paladin into the ranks of the Crusade.
A few years later, Taelan Fordring realized how far the Scarlet Crusade had fallen from its noble purpose, and defected. As he made his way down the road from Hearthglen, he was met by Isillien, who was ordered by Grand Crusader Dathrohan to eliminate him. He was willing to do this for pleasure, not of obligation or duty; for he considered the Fordring bloodline weak. The Inquisitor stroked down Taelan. Not long after, Tirion Fordring arrived and, upon seeing his son's body, flew into a rage and attacked the Crusader, killing him.
